Rec Room Basics

For those who have never planned out a rec room before, there are a few things to consider. Before the beginning decoration process, make sure you understand where the recreational room is going and what purposes the room will serve. Consider factors such as:

  • The Location - Many homeowners plan their recreational room ideas in their basement, which can add a bit of privacy to the room. Consider making the room feel separate from the rest of the home. Garages and empty bedrooms can also be common locations for recreational rooms. 
  • The Ultimate Purpose - Do you plan to transform your rec room into a game room where your family and friends can play together? Do you plan to turn your extra space into a gym? Maybe you just want a quiet place to escape from work. How you plan on using the room can determine what kind of furniture and decor to put in it. 
  • The Budget - Consider your budget when building a rec room. There is a lot of flexibility in costs when it comes to decorating your room and filling it with various game tables. Keep in mind that although it is nice to have a budget, the rec room should still meet the design and utility needs you originally wanted. Make it a space that gives you what you need.
